Sans Superellipse Rilup 2 is a very light, very narrow, high cont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

A hairline, condensed display face with extreme stroke contrast and a predominantly vertical, upright posture. The letterforms are built from tall, narrow proportions with long ascenders and descenders, producing a strong vertical rhythm and lots of white space inside and around counters. Curves are clean and controlled, with rounded, superellipse-like bowls in letters such as O and Q, while many joins and terminals resolve into sharp, tapered points. Overall spacing feels airy and measured, emphasizing line-to-line elegance over dense texture.

Best suited to large-scale applications such as editorial headlines, fashion and beauty branding, mastheads, and boutique logotypes. It can also work well on posters, invitations, and premium packaging where the slender forms and high contrast can be showcased without crowding.

The font communicates a poised, high-fashion tone with a theatrical edge. Its razor-thin strokes and narrow stance feel luxurious and deliberate, evoking runway branding, magazine mastheads, and upscale packaging. The overall impression is sophisticated and modern, with a cool, minimal charisma.

The design appears intended as a refined, high-contrast condensed display font that prioritizes elegance, verticality, and a sleek contemporary silhouette. Its superellipse-leaning round forms and hairline detailing aim to deliver a distinctive, upscale voice for branding and editorial use.

In text settings the contrast creates a shimmering cadence, especially where vertical stems dominate. The delicate horizontals and hairline details suggest it will be most comfortable when given generous size and breathing room, and when reproduced with sufficient print/screen fidelity to preserve thin strokes.
